DUSHANBE, September 28, Asia-Plus - Another drug trafficking attempt has been warded off in Sughd.
According to the Ministry of Interior (MoI), traffic police officers found more than one kilogram of heroin yesterday, when searching a car VAZ-2106 at the checkpoint in the Qistakuz settlement in the northern district of Bobojonghafurov. The car driver, a 22-year-old resident of Isfara Hasan Qahhorov, and his passenger, a 39-year-old Amon Sultonov, were detained on suspicion of having been involved in drug trafficking. Investigation is under way.
Since the beginning of the year, Tajik police have seized some 1,500 kilograms of drugs, according to the source.
